TEHRAN, Aug. 10 (Xinhua) -- Iranian President Masoud Pezeshkian said Monday that Iran's Supreme Leader Mojtaba Khamenei is in perfect health.

He made the remarks in an interview with state-run IRIB TV while commenting on his recent "seven-hour" meeting with the supreme leader.

Commenting on the meeting, Pezeshkian said maintaining national unity and solidarity was the most important issue stressed by the supreme leader.

He said the meeting was "very good," listing people's livelihood, employment and housing among the most important issues discussed.

"We also talked about the problems resulting from sanctions," he added.

Iranian media reported on Sunday that Pezeshkian met the supreme leader as he began his third year in office as president.

Mojtaba Khamenei was selected as Iran's new supreme leader by the country's Assembly of Experts in March after his father and former supreme leader Ali Khamenei was killed in joint U.S. and Israeli strikes on Feb. 28.

Mojtaba Khamenei has not appeared in public since his election.
